Staff Pharmacist Part-Time Optum
Overview
Optum seeks a part‑time Staff Pharmacist in Dallas to deliver accurate medication handling and clinical support. You will work alongside over 2,500 professionals to improve patient outcomes across hospital and pharmacy services.
What You'll Do7
- 1Review and dispense medication orders to ensure safety and accuracy
- 2Provide clinical pharmacy services including medication therapy management
- 3Collaborate with physicians and care teams to optimize medication regimens
- 4Oversee compounding activities meeting USP and hospital standards
- 5Monitor patient outcomes and prevent adverse drug events
- 6Supervise pharmacy technicians and interns to maintain efficient workflow
- 7Ensure regulatory compliance with Joint Commission and federal requirements
Requirements5
- 1Pharmacy degree from ACPE accredited school; PharmD preferred
- 2Current Texas pharmacist license in good standing
- 3Experience with pharmacy information systems and clinical documentation
- 4Ability to work independently and prioritize tasks effectively
- 5Strong attention to detail and commitment to patient safety
